Description and Service Details | |
Description (Service) | A program that provides temporary financial assistance to individuals returning to the workforce
If you qualify, Ontario Works Halton can also provide: Financial Assistance-- to help cover the cost of basic needs like food and housing * you may also be eligible to receive other benefits including: prescription drug and dental coverage * eye glasses * diabetic supplies * moving costs * employment-related costs * the amount received depends on family size, income, assets and housing costs Employment Assistance-- help to prepare for and find a job * education programs * literacy training * learning/earning/parenting (LEAP) * job specific skills training * employment placements * community placements Welfare Fraud Hotline 416-392-8980 -- to report allegations of fraudulent collection of Ontario Works and Ontario Disability Support Program assistance |

Eligibility | To be eligible to receive help from Ontario Works you must * live in Ontario * be willing to take part in activities that will help you find a job * meet all other eligibility criteria |
